如何设计一个基于单片机的测距系统,使其能够应用于温室环境测控并实现数据的多传感器采集与传输?
时间: 2024-11-23 21:33:08 浏览: 17
要设计一个基于单片机的测距系统,适用于温室环境测控,并能实现多传感器数据采集与传输,你需要掌握一系列的专业技术。首先,选择合适的单片机,如Arduino或STM32系列,它们都具备足够的I/O端口和处理能力来处理传感器数据。接下来,针对测距需求,可以采用超声波传感器或红外传感器来实现距离测量。例如,超声波传感器通过发射超声波并接收其回波来计算距离,这一过程由单片机的定时器和I/O端口控制。
参考资源链接:[自动化专业本科毕业设计论文热门课题汇总](https://wenku.csdn.net/doc/4r55b3c1ez?spm=1055.2569.3001.10343)
在温室环境测控方面,你可能需要测量温度、湿度、光照强度等环境参数。选择相应的传感器,如DHT11或DHT22用于温湿度测量,光敏电阻或光敏二极管用于光照测量。通过模拟数字转换器(ADC)接口将模拟信号转换为数字信号,由单片机进行处理和分析。
对于多传感器数据采集与传输,你需要设计一个合理的数据采集系统。这涉及到硬件选择、传感器布局规划以及数据融合算法的应用。在硬件方面,可以使用多路模拟开关和ADC来扩展单片机的I/O能力,支持更多传感器接入。软件上,需要编写程序来周期性地读取各个传感器数据,并通过串口通信或无线模块(如Wi-Fi、蓝牙、ZigBee)将数据发送到中央监控系统。此外,数据传输前通常需要进行编码和加密,确保数据的完整性和安全性。
在设计过程中,还需要考虑到电源管理,确保系统稳定运行且能效最优。最后,进行系统的调试和测试,验证系统的准确性和可靠性。为了更深入地理解和掌握这些技术,建议参阅《自动化专业本科毕业设计论文热门课题汇总》,这份资料不仅包含了测距系统和温室环境测控的项目,还提供了多传感器数据采集与传输的实践经验,以及与PLC控制系统、移动通讯监控等其他相关技术的交叉应用案例。通过阅读这些案例,你将能更好地整合各项技术,设计出更加完善和高效的系统。
参考资源链接:[自动化专业本科毕业设计论文热门课题汇总](https://wenku.csdn.net/doc/4r55b3c1ez?spm=1055.2569.3001.10343)
阅读全文